Technical Detail
Most load cell catalogs list the same few specs—capacity, accuracy class, output signal. At Kingmach, we’ve built a range around the applications that actually drive purchasing decisions. The lineup includes shear beam, S-type, single-point, and compression load cells, with capacities from a few kilograms for benchtop scales to several hundred tonnes for geotechnical anchor monitoring. Many models ship with IP65 or IP67 sealing as the default, not as a premium upgrade, which keeps things simple when you’re installing in dusty factories or wet slope instrumentation. Material options like alloy steel and stainless steel are available across series, and we’ll commonly adjust cable length, connector type, or mounting base dimensions to match a project’s wiring plan or mechanical constraints. On the electronics side, standard outputs include 2 mV/V, 4-20 mA, and 0-5 V, making it easy to integrate with PLCs or data loggers already in use. Customization tends to center on combined sensors—embedding a load cell within a borehole extensometer or pairing it with a displacement transducer for early warning systems. Shear beam or double-ended shear beam load cells often work well for hoppers, because they handle off-center loads and are simpler to mount. If you share the hopper geometry and capacity range with our team, we can recommend a specific model and mounting arrangement.
Standard mV/V output is widely compatible with industrial indicators and many PLC input modules. If your system runs on 4-20 mA or 0-5 V, we can supply load cells with built-in signal conditioning. Just specify the interface when ordering, and we’ll make sure the signal matches your controller.
